Big River flows fifty five miles westward from the rugged Coast Range into Mendocino Bay. Due to its slight gradient, the lower eight miles are tidal, providing paddlers with good depth year round. Nestled within California’s newest state park, the Big River estuary–including its abundant wildlife and adjacent lands–is now permanently protected. Fern Canyon is an awesome sight. This picturesque and primeval-looking setting, used in the filming of several movies, is a must-see part of Redwood National and State Parks. Five species of ferns grow on its vertical walls. Its waterfalls, meandering creek, and meadows are even more amazing when interpreted by one of our expert guides.

Only 3% of the Redwoods that originally blanketed the Pacific Coast still stand. Come walk through time in beautiful Redwood National Park where many of the few remaining old growth coastal redwoods are still preserved from being cut down and turned into decks and picnic tables. You will walk through groves of leviathan trees that are centuries or even millennia old and can grow more than 350' tall.
